About Our Equipment

Ski-Doo Summit 850x165 Turbo:

  • Perfect for deep powder
  • Heated hand grips
  • Experienced riders only
  • Mountain riding only

Ski-Doo Summit 850x154:

  • Perfect for deep powder
  • Heated hand grips
  • Experienced riders
  • Mountain riding only

Ski-doo Grand Touring 600x137:

  • Perfect for trail riding and beginners
  • Heated hand grips & electric start

Ski-Doo Backcountry 600x146:

  • Perfect for trail riding and beginners
  • Heated hand grips & electric start

Adventure Tips

Dress in Layers

Wear moisture-wicking base layers, insulating mid-layers, and waterproof outerwear to stay comfortable in cold conditions.

Check Weather Conditions

Always review current weather and snow conditions before heading out to ensure safety and enjoyment.

Stay on Marked Trails

Follow designated routes to avoid hazards and protect the environment.

Carry Emergency Supplies

Bring a small first aid kit, extra warm clothing, and a fully charged cell phone for safety.
